Mr. Walker was hiking across Massachusetts. He has three days to cover 70 miles. On the first day, he walked 6 hours at a speed

of 4 mph. On the second day he walked the same number of hours, but his speed was only 3 mph. On the third day, he walked 8 hours to cover the remaining distance. What was his speed on the third day?

So 6 hours at 4 miles per hour
4 miles per hour means 4 mieles in one hour
6 hours
distance=time times (distance pers unit of time)
distance=6 times 4=24

second day
same number of hours=6
speed=3

distance=time times (distance per units of time)
distance=6 times 3=18

so we add 1 and 2 days together
24+18=42
so he has covered 42 mles
he eed to cover 70
70=42+rest
subtract 42
28=rest

so he traveled 28 miles on third day
in 8 hours
sppeed=distance divided by time
time=8
distance=28
28/8=14/4=7/2=3 and 1/2 miles per hour=3.5 miles per hour

answer is 3.5 miles per hour

Let f(x)= 100 / −10+ e^ −0.1x . What is f(−6) ?

The value of f(-6) is -12.2

Explanation:

Given that the function f(x)=\frac{100}{-10+e^{-0.1\left(x\right)}}

We need to determine the value of f(-6)

The value of f(-6) can be determined by substituting the value for x=-6 in the function and simplify the function.

Hence, let us substitute x=-6 in the function, we get,

f(-6)=\frac{100}{-10+e^{-0.1\left(-6\right)}}

Let us apply the rule -\left(-a\right)=a , we get,

f(-6)=\frac{100}{-10+e^{0.1\left(6\right)}}

Multiplying the numbers, we get,

f(-6)=\frac{100}{-10+e^{0.6}}

The value of e^{0.6}=1.822

Substituting the value of e^{0.6}=1.822 , we get,

f(-6)=\frac{100}{-10+1.822}

Subtracting the denominator, we have,

f(-6)=\frac{100}{-8.178}

Dividing, we have,

f(-6)=-12.228

Rounding off to the nearest tenth, we have,

f(-6)=-12.2

Thus, the value of f(-6) is -12.2
